Steps for Site Preparation
Proper site dive in preparation is vital for a successful concrete installation process. Initially, the area must be cleared of debris, vegetation, and any existing structures. This step provides a clean, stable foundation. Following this, the soil is evaluated for compaction and drainage capabilities; if necessary, it may be compacted or treated to increase st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also essential, as they define the shape and dimensions of the concrete pour. Finally, reinforcing materials, such as rebar or wire mesh, are positioned to enhance the concrete's strength. Proper execution of these steps lays the groundwork for a durable and reliable concrete structure.
The Significance of Proper Curing
Despite being often ignored, the curing process plays an essential role in the success of a concrete installation. This phase initiates promptly once the concrete is poured and requires preserving adequate moisture, temperature, and time to permit the concrete to attain its intended strength and durability. Proper curing stops complications including cracking, surface scaling, and weaknesses in the material. Techniques may include covering the surface with wet burlap, using curing compounds, or applying plastic sheeting to keep moisture in. Typically, the curing period spans from a few days to several weeks, depending on environmental conditions and the specific concrete mix used. Understanding the significance of this process guarantees that the final structure remains sturdy and enduring, meeting the expectations of clients.

Regular Cleaning Practices
Consistent maintenance practices are crucial for sustaining the lifespan and look of concrete surfaces. Routine maintenance, for instance removing debris and dirt, assists in avoiding staining and deterioration. Power cleaning efficiently eliminates difficult discolorations, algae, or moss that may accumulate over time. It is suggested to use a soft cleanser during this process to stop chemical damage. Moreover, promptly addressing spills, especially from oil or chemicals, can stop permanent discoloration. In colder climates, taking away snow and ice is vital to prevent cracking due to ice expansion. Routine checks for cracks or surface wear can also support identifying issues early, guaranteeing that concrete surfaces remain resilient and good-looking for years to come.
Frequency of Sealant Application
Generally, putting on a sealant to concrete surfaces every one through three years is important for upholding their durability and aesthetics. This interval relies on factors including weather conditions, foot traffic, and the type of sealant used. Consistent inspections can aid in establishing when reapplication is required; symptoms like discoloration, wear, or water penetration demonstrate that the sealant has degraded. Homeowners should select premium sealants intended for their specific concrete applications, ensuring better durability. Moreover, proper surface preparation before application improves adhesion and effectiveness. By adhering to this maintenance schedule, property owners can preserve their concrete investments, prolonging the lifespan of surfaces and reducing costly repairs in the future.
Future Trends and Innovations in Contemporary Concrete Systems
How is the concrete field transforming to satisfy the requirements of a fast-paced changing environment? Breakthroughs in concrete technology are creating a more environmentally responsible and resilient future. Researchers are creating eco-friendly alternatives, such as recycled aggregates and bio-based additives, which decrease the carbon footprint of concrete production. Furthermore, developments in smart concrete—incorporating sensors that monitor structural health—enable proactive maintenance, boosting safety and durability.
Yet another growing trend is the utilization of 3D printing innovation, facilitating quick construction of complex structures with minimal waste. Moreover, self-healing concrete, which employs bacteria or different materials to repair cracks automatically, is gaining traction, delivering more durable infrastructures.
As urbanization grows and climate change impacts construction practices, these innovations reflect the industry's dedication to sustainability and efficiency. The future of concrete technology contains vast possibilities for transforming how society builds, delivering structures that are resilient and environmentally sustainable.

What's the Standard Timeframe for Concrete to Cure Completely?
Concrete generally requires approximately 28 days to reach full cure, even though preliminary setting begins within several hours. Elements including temperature, humidity, and mix design can influence the curing process and overall strength development.
Which Types of Concrete Finishes Can You Get?
Various concrete finishes comprise polished, stamped, exposed aggregate, brushed, and troweled. Each finish features distinct aesthetics and textures, addressing different design preferences and functional requirements in residential and commercial applications.
Can You Pour Concrete During Cold Weather?
Indeed, concrete can be poured in cold weather, but certain precautions are necessary. Proper techniques and materials, such as heated water and insulating blankets, help guarantee the concrete cures properly despite lower temperatures.
How Should I Handle Cracked Concrete?
When cracks form in concrete, evaluate the scope of the damage. Small fissures can be filled with a concrete patching compound, while larger cracks will require professional evaluation and repair to maintain structural integrity and prevent subsequent complications.
What Are the Signs That My Concrete Needs Resurfacing?
To determine if concrete necessitates resurfacing, you should look for obvious cracks, uneven surfaces, or discoloration. Moreover, pooling water or a rough texture might suggest that resurfacing is needed for better aesthetics and functionality.
